我正在尝试使用linux上的python3创建一个动态IP解析器,以查询windows服务器并返回将给出的IP。我的目的是将返回的IP地址作为FreeRADIUS中的框架IP地址提供,并将其转发给SSO代理。
我对这个python脚本进行了修改,以获取mac地址参数并构建DHCP请求。当我通过WireShark运行它时,我看到DHCP请求使用的是参数,但是DHCP服务器返回的IP与它应该返回的IP不同。
Windows 2008 DHCP服务器上是否有任何防止“欺骗”DHCP请求的安全措施?在linux上是否有类似于windows:netsh dhcp server <type.srvI
我用的是Ubuntu12.04。最近我不能再安装任何东西了。我总是收到以下错误消息:
Setting up linux-image-3.2.0-34-generic (3.2.0-34.53) ...
Running depmod.
update-initramfs: deferring update (hook will be called later)
Use of chdir('') or chdir(undef) as chdir() is deprecated at /var/lib/dpkg/inf/linux-image-3.2.0-34-generic.post
在为64位发行版编译和运行我的应用程序时,我收到了下面的错误(版本只是在调试时没有优化级别的-O2 )。
32位调试版本运行正常。64位调试版本崩溃(这是我正在尝试解决的问题),但是64位版本给了我这个错误。我猜他们是有关联的--但不能百分之百肯定。
以下是错误:
./tester_x64Linux: relocation error: /home/user/development/lib/libcontroller_library_x64Linux.so.0: symbol nanosleep version GLIBC_2.2.5 not defined in file libpthrea
我在IP 192.168.1.200上的本地网络上有LINUX web服务器(这是Xtreamer nas服务器),我想通过win笔记本从本地wifi访问它。
我有主机文件记录192.168.1.200 server.com
请注意,ping server.com会按预期返回192.168.1.200
有人能解释一下为什么吗?
192.168.1.200:8080如期返回xtreamer配置页面
但
server.com:8080返回
Forbidden You don't have permission to access / on this server. Microsoft-II
顾名思义,mdadm一直将驱动器标记为“删除”(从mdadm -详细信息中删除),而我希望能得到关于为什么会发生这种情况的建议。
我想伪造驱动器,但是我得到了以下错误:
$ fsck /dev/sda1
fsck from util-linux 2.20.1
fsck: fsck.linux_raid_member: not found
fsck: error 2 while executing fsck.linux_raid_member for /dev/sda1
从那以后,我了解到内部位图将有助于阻止我需要--添加第三个驱动器,并避免重新同步进程/时间,但是我假设我需要先添加第三个磁盘,
在Unix环境中检测过时pid文件的标准、跨平台方法是什么?假设我想要终止应用程序的一个旧实例,但如果应用程序已经退出,我肯定不想中断具有相同PID的无关进程。
现在我找到了一种在我的Ubuntu (因此可能是其他基于GNU/Linux的系统)上做这件事的方法--伪代码如下:
if ( mtime(pid_file) < mtime( "/proc/"+pid ) ) {
/* process started AFTER the file creation */
/* so it's not what we're looking for
使用GDB,我试图修改一个全局变量。全局变量是在共享库中定义的--不确定这是否有任何区别。但我得到一个错误“无法访问成员”。以下是我正在做的事情:
$ gdb /usr/lib/libmylib.so
GNU gdb (GDB) Red Hat Enterprise Linux (7.2-56.el6)
...
(gdb) p GlobalVar1
$1 = 0
(gdb) info variable GlobalVar1
All variables matching regular expression "GlobalVar1":
File src/file.cc:
s
我们有一个供应商为我们开发一个linux服务器,公开一个REST。我们正在开发一个使用此REST的客户端应用程序。运行此客户端应用程序的多个客户端协同工作,例如具有聊天功能。现在,我想使用rest编写测试,以验证用于此聊天功能的服务器逻辑是否有效。“如果客户端泰山在发送信息,客户端Jane会收到正确的消息吗?”
我正在考虑这样的事情(伪代码):
client_tarzan = createclient()
client_jane = createclient()
#the actual login logic is hidden to make the example easier
clie
在使用backward-cpp库的ARM机器上抛出异常后,我正在尝试恢复我的程序堆栈跟踪。在AMD64机器上运行简单程序时,以下代码返回预期的堆栈跟踪: #include <backward/backward.hpp>
backward::SignalHandling sh{};
int main() {
throw 1;
} terminate called after throwing an instance of 'int'
Stack trace (most recent call last):
#9 Object "",
我正在尝试让我的电子应用程序在linux上运行。它在Windows上运行得很好。当我尝试'npm ci‘时,我得到以下错误: sh: 1: install-app-deps: not found 我在谷歌上没有找到任何有用的东西。我猜这可能是我的电子锻造谁可以成为这个麻烦的来源,但我不知道有什么转机。 我的Package.json: {
"name": "roseplayer",
"version": "0.0.2",
"description": "A webradio player
因此,就上下文而言,我有两个虚拟机,一个在kali linux上运行,它是"Hacker's“机器,另一个运行在windows 10 pro上,它应该是受害者的机器。
因此,今天我尝试通过Bettercap进行arp欺骗/中毒,当启动欺骗时,它可以工作,它实际上改变了windows机器上路由器的mac地址,但是每当我启动进程时,我就会在windows虚拟机上失去与Internet的连接,并且在我的以太网图标旁边出现一个黄色图标。
当我试图“排除”问题时,它会输出Problems found: Windows can't communicate with the dev